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by Banco Bradesco S.A. covers the month of January 2020. The report is a consolidated disclosure of transactions involving securities and derivatives by the company's administration, family dependents, and various controlled or related entities, in compliance with Instruction CVM No. 358/2002, Paragraph 11.
Key Financial Metrics and Shareholdings
The filing does not contain consolidated financial statements, revenue, profit, or cash flow data. It focuses exclusively on equity holdings and specific trading activities.
- Group and Family Dependents: Held 2,863,698,306 Common Shares (35.51% total participation) and 90,959,509 Non-Voting Shares (1.13% total participation). No trading activity occurred in January 2020.
- Board of Directors: Held 22,035,273 Common Shares and 40,381,427 Non-Voting Shares. No trading activity occurred.
- Treasury: Held 6,642,963 Common Shares and 24,889,584 Non-Voting Shares. No trading activity occurred.
- Controlled/Related Entities: The vast majority of listed subsidiaries and related companies (e.g., Bradesco Leasing, Cielo, Bradesco Seguros) reported zero holdings and zero trading activity for the period.
Material Changes and Trading Activity
The only material trading activity reported in the filing occurred within the Board of Executive Officers category.
- Activity: Multiple sales of Non-Voting Shares were executed between January 2 and January 13, 2020.
- Total Volume: 46,176 Non-Voting Shares sold.
- Total Value: R$ 1,715,472.77.
- Price Range: Shares were sold at prices ranging from approximately R$ 34.76 to R$ 37.49.
- Balance Change: The closing balance for Non-Voting Shares held by the Board of Executive Officers decreased from 1,503,326 to 1,432,058.
- Personnel Change: The filing notes that Frederico William Wolf left the Board of Executive Officers during the period.
